Caution in the market

Given the current situation, large investors are not showing much interest in commodities like gold and silver. Uncertainty persists in the market, so most investors are currently employing a wait-and-see approach.

This is why prices are fluctuating and even declining, as investors wait for clarity rather than making hasty decisions.

Is now the right time to buy?

The recent drop in prices has presented a good opportunity for the common man. Especially in India, the demand for jewelry increases sharply as the wedding season begins, and jewellery shops are crowded.

In such an environment, this decline in the commodity market could prove to be a profitable deal for those who have been waiting for a fall in prices for a long time.
